- W2077824956 abstract "The authors investigate the no-boundary path integral prescription in a Regge calculus model in three spacetime dimensions. The simplicial manifold is topologically the 'doughnut' D*S1, where D is the two-dimensional closed disc. The discretization and the edge lengths are chosen symmetrically so that the boundary 2-metric is completely described by two independent edge lengths, and the interior 3-metric is completely described by these plus two further independent edge lengths. They pass to a limit in which the discretization on the boundary becomes infinitely dense. The classical solutions in the resulting semi-continuum model are in qualitative agreement with the solutions to the continuum Einstein equations with the same boundary data. Convergent contours for the no-boundary integral in the semi-continuum model are sought in analogy with the conformal rotation prescription of Gibbons et al (1978) and using steepest-descent techniques to analyse the contours for the conformal factor. A convergent prescription is found in the case of a vanishing cosmological constant, and the resulting wavefunction is shown to have the expected semiclassical behaviour. Possible reasons for the authors not being able to find a similar prescription with a non-vanishing cosmological constant are discussed." @default.
